阿里云国际站代理商:ASP分页控件分页技术解析与优势结合
1. 标题分析与核心内容概述
标题“阿里云国际站代理商:ASP分页控件分页”包含三个关键信息点:
- 阿里云国际站代理商:表明服务主体为阿里云的跨境业务合作伙伴,需结合其全球化资源和技术支持能力。
- ASP分页控件:指基于Active Server Pages技术的动态网页数据分页组件,适用于企业级Web应用开发。
- 分页功能实现:强调技术落地方向,需兼顾性能优化与用户体验。
下文将围绕这三部分展开,阐述阿里云如何赋能代理商实现高效分页解决方案。
2. ASP分页控件的技术挑战与需求
传统ASP分页面临的主要问题:

- 数据库压力:全表查询导致I/O负载高,响应延迟。
- 扩展性局限:单机部署难以应对突发流量。
- 开发复杂度:需手动编写分页逻辑,维护成本高。
现代需求升级:云原生架构下需要支持弹性伸缩、多地域访问和API集成能力。
3. 阿里云技术栈的整合优势
3.1 高性能数据库支持
阿里云PolarDB提供:
- 分页查询优化:通过
OFFSET-FETCH语法和索引推荐降低查询耗时。 - 读写分离:代理层自动分流,分担主库压力。
- 数据缓存:配合Redis缓存热点分页数据,TPS提升5倍以上。
3.2 Serverless无服务器架构
通过函数计算FC实现:
- 动态扩缩容:根据请求量自动调整资源,成本降低60%。
- 免运维部署:聚焦业务逻辑开发,无需管理服务器。
- 与API网关集成:快速构建分页RESTful接口。
3.3 全球化加速网络
阿里云全球加速GA方案:
- 智能路由选择:跨国访问延迟控制在150ms内。
- 多可用区部署:数据分片存储,提升区域访问效率。
4. 典型实现方案示例
4.1 架构设计
用户端 → 阿里云CDN → API网关 → 函数计算 → PolarDB(主从架构)
↑
Redis缓存集群
4.2 核心代码片段(伪代码)
Function GetPagedData(pageIndex, pageSize) {
// 从Redis查询缓存
cacheKey = $"page_{pageIndex}_{pageSize}";
if(Redis.Exists(cacheKey))
return Json.Parse(Redis.Get(cacheKey));
// 数据库分页查询
sql = $"SELECT * FROM products ORDER BY id OFFSET {(pageIndex-1)*pageSize} FETCH NEXT {pageSize}";
result = PolarDB.Query(sql);
// 写入缓存并设置TTL
Redis.Set(cacheKey, result.ToJson(), expire: TimeSpan.FromMinutes(10));
return result;
}
5. 价值收益分析
| 维度 | 传统方案 | 阿里云整合方案 |
|---|---|---|
| 响应速度 | 800-1200ms | ≤200ms |
| 并发能力 | 500 QPS | ≥3000 QPS |
| 运维成本 | 需专职DBA | 托管服务零运维 |
6. 总结
阿里云国际站代理商通过整合PolarDB、函数计算和全球加速等云服务,可构建高性能、低延迟的ASP分页解决方案。该方案不仅解决了传统分页控件的性能瓶颈,还通过Serverless架构大幅降低运维复杂度,特别适合跨国电商、SaaS应用等需要处理海量数据分页的场景。结合阿里云的生态资源,代理商能够为客户提供更具竞争力的技术增值服务,同时实现自身服务能力的数字化转型。
